Why Micro-Partitions in Snowflake Are Immutable Matters

Understanding the immutability of micro-partitions in Snowflake is essential for anyone looking to optimize their data management and analytics. This article delves into why this characteristic is crucial for data integrity, query performance, and effective historical data management.

Multiple Choice

Are micro-partitions in Snowflake immutable?

Explanation:
Micro-partitions in Snowflake are indeed immutable, meaning that once they are created, they cannot be modified. This characteristic is crucial for several reasons. Firstly, immutability contributes to the consistency and integrity of the data. By ensuring that data doesn't change after it's stored, Snowflake can offer a reliable view of the data as it existed at the time it was partitioned. This is especially important in scenarios involving time travel or when maintaining historical data for analytical purposes. Secondly, because micro-partitions are immutable, they allow Snowflake to leverage an efficient storage model that optimizes performance. When data is written, it's stored in these micro-partitions, which are then compressed and indexed for faster query performance. Overall, the immutability of micro-partitions plays a vital role in enhancing data protection, query efficiency, and simplifying data management within the Snowflake environment.

When you think about data storage today, what stands out? Is it the speed of access? The reliability? Most would say it’s a combination of both. For those studying for the Snowflake SnowPro Certification, one crucial concept you'll encounter is the immutability of micro-partitions. But what does that actually mean, and why should it matter to you?

Let me explain the core idea: Micro-partitions in Snowflake are immutable. So, once these little data nuggets are created, they don't change. Isn’t that kinda cool? It might sound technical at first, but this concept plays a pivotal role in ensuring data consistency and integrity—two buzzwords that are often the backbone of any successful data management strategy.

Now, imagine you’re working with time-sensitive data; you need to know that what you see is what it was back then, am I right? By keeping data unchanged after it's stored, Snowflake allows users to access historical snapshots of their data—perfect for auditing and analysis. Think of it as a photo album, where each photo captures a specific moment in time, and you can revisit those moments anytime.

But wait, it gets better! The immutability of micro-partitions isn’t just a safety net; it also enhances performance. When Snowflake writes data, it organizes it into these neat little micro-partitions, compressing and indexing them for superior query speed. This means faster access to your data without sacrificing accuracy or reliability. It’s like having a well-organized bookshelf; you can find what you need in an instant!

So why does it matter? Well, as you prepare for your SnowPro Certification, grasping these concepts isn’t just about passing a test—it's about understanding the very framework of how Snowflake operates. The immutable nature of micro-partitions ensures data protection and simplifies management. When your storage is neat and tidy, querying becomes a breeze!

Are you starting to see the bigger picture? Data management isn’t just techy jargon; it’s a blend of understanding time travel in data, performance optimization, and making sense of how we maintain historical data integrity. It’s an approach that combines theory with practice, allowing for both innovation and tradition in analytics.

And speaking of navigation, think of Snowflake as the GPS in your data journey. With a clear understanding of micro-partitions, you’re not just moving through the data landscape; you’re navigating it with precision, ensuring every query leads to valuable insights.

In summary, understanding the immutability of micro-partitions is a key insight that will not only aid in your studies but will also empower your professional journey as you dive into the world of data analytics. Just remember: the next time you think of data storage, think of it as a snapshot in time—clear, reliable, and most importantly, immutable. This might just be one of the most vital concepts in mastering Snowflake!

So, are you ready to tackle the SnowPro Certification with a firm grasp of concepts like these? I bet you are! Keep pushing forward; the world of data awaits!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y